| Commit message (Expand) | Author | Age | Files | Lines |
* | treewide: Remove uninitialized_var() usage | Kees Cook | 2020-07-16 | 1 | -1/+1 |
* | radix-tree: Use local_lock for protection | Sebastian Andrzej Siewior | 2020-05-28 | 1 | -11/+9 |
* | ida: remove abandoned macros | Alex Shi | 2020-01-31 | 1 | -8/+0 |
* | idr: Fix idr_alloc_u32 on 32-bit systems | Matthew Wilcox (Oracle) | 2019-11-03 | 1 | -1/+1 |
* |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 153 | Thomas Gleixner | 2019-05-30 | 1 | -14/+1 |
* | radix tree: Don't return retry entries from lookup | Matthew Wilcox | 2018-12-06 | 1 | -2/+2 |
* | radix tree: Remove multiorder support | Matthew Wilcox | 2018-10-21 | 1 | -202/+13 |
* | radix tree test suite: Convert tag_tagged_items to XArray | Matthew Wilcox | 2018-10-21 | 1 | -12/+0 |
* | radix tree: Remove radix_tree_clear_tags | Matthew Wilcox | 2018-10-21 | 1 | -13/+0 |
* | radix tree: Remove radix_tree_maybe_preload_order | Matthew Wilcox | 2018-10-21 | 1 | -74/+0 |
* | radix tree: Remove split/join code | Matthew Wilcox | 2018-10-21 | 1 | -169/+2 |
* | radix tree: Remove radix_tree_update_node_t | Matthew Wilcox | 2018-10-21 | 1 | -34/+8 |
* | shmem: Convert shmem_alloc_hugepage to XArray | Matthew Wilcox | 2018-10-21 | 1 | -43/+1 |
* | page cache: Add and replace pages using the XArray | Matthew Wilcox | 2018-10-21 | 1 | -3/+3 |
* | ida: Convert to XArray | Matthew Wilcox | 2018-10-21 | 1 | -71/+0 |
* | xarray: Add XArray unconditional store operations | Matthew Wilcox | 2018-10-21 | 1 | -2/+2 |
* | xarray: Add XArray load operation | Matthew Wilcox | 2018-10-21 | 1 | -43/+0 |
* | xarray: Define struct xa_node | Matthew Wilcox | 2018-10-21 | 1 | -24/+24 |
* | xarray: Add definition of struct xarray | Matthew Wilcox | 2018-10-21 | 1 | -38/+37 |
* | xarray: Change definition of sibling entries | Matthew Wilcox | 2018-09-30 | 1 | -45/+19 |
* | xarray: Replace exceptional entries | Matthew Wilcox | 2018-09-30 | 1 | -12/+9 |
* | idr: Permit any valid kernel pointer to be stored | Matthew Wilcox | 2018-09-30 | 1 | -6/+15 |
* | ida: Remove old API | Matthew Wilcox | 2018-08-22 | 1 | -9/+0 |
* | radix-tree: Fix UBSAN warning | Matthew Wilcox | 2018-08-22 | 1 | -1/+1 |
* | idr: fix invalid ptr dereference on item delete | Matthew Wilcox | 2018-05-26 | 1 | -1/+3 |
* | radix tree: fix multi-order iteration race | Ross Zwisler | 2018-05-19 | 1 | -4/+2 |
* | radix tree: use GFP_ZONEMASK bits of gfp_t for flags | Matthew Wilcox | 2018-04-11 | 1 | -1/+2 |
* | ida: do zeroing in ida_pre_get() | Rasmus Villemoes | 2018-02-22 | 1 | -1/+1 |
* | idr: Remove idr_alloc_ext | Matthew Wilcox | 2018-02-06 | 1 | -1/+2 |
* | mm, truncate: do not check mapping for every page being truncated | Mel Gorman | 2017-11-16 | 1 | -17/+13 |
* | radix-tree: must check __radix_tree_preload() return value | Eric Dumazet | 2017-09-09 | 1 | -4/+5 |
* |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next | Linus Torvalds | 2017-09-06 | 1 | -3/+3 |
|\ |
|
| * | idr: Add new APIs to support unsigned long | Chris Mi | 2017-08-30 | 1 | -3/+3 |
* | | drm/i915: Replace execbuf vma ht with an idr | Chris Wilson | 2017-08-18 | 1 | -0/+1 |
|/ |
|
* | lockdep: allow to disable reclaim lockup detection | Michal Hocko | 2017-05-04 | 1 | -0/+2 |
* | ida: Free correct IDA bitmap | Matthew Wilcox | 2017-03-07 | 1 | -2/+2 |
* | Merge branch 'idr-4.11' of git://git.infradead.org/users/willy/linux-dax | Linus Torvalds | 2017-03-01 | 1 | -229/+532 |
|\ |
|
| * | radix-tree: Fix __rcu annotations | Matthew Wilcox | 2017-02-14 | 1 | -59/+66 |
| * | radix-tree: Add rcu_dereference and rcu_assign_pointer calls | Matthew Wilcox | 2017-02-14 | 1 | -11/+15 |
| * | radix_tree_iter_resume: Fix out of bounds error | Matthew Wilcox | 2017-02-14 | 1 | -1/+0 |
| * | radix-tree: Store a pointer to the root in each node | Matthew Wilcox | 2017-02-14 | 1 | -6/+8 |
| * | radix-tree: Chain preallocated nodes through ->parent | Matthew Wilcox | 2017-02-14 | 1 | -5/+4 |
| * | ida: Use exceptional entries for small IDAs | Matthew Wilcox | 2017-02-14 | 1 | -0/+8 |
| * | ida: Move ida_bitmap to a percpu variable | Matthew Wilcox | 2017-02-14 | 1 | -3/+42 |
| * | Reimplement IDR and IDA using the radix tree | Matthew Wilcox | 2017-02-14 | 1 | -88/+287 |
| * | radix-tree: Add radix_tree_iter_delete | Matthew Wilcox | 2017-02-13 | 1 | -31/+60 |
| * | radix-tree: Add radix_tree_iter_tag_clear() | Matthew Wilcox | 2017-02-13 | 1 | -28/+40 |
| * | radix tree: constify some pointers | Matthew Wilcox | 2017-01-28 | 1 | -26/+31 |
* | | EXPORT_SYMBOL radix_tree_replace_slot | Song Liu | 2017-02-13 | 1 | -0/+1 |
|/ |
|
* | radix-tree: fix private list warnings | Matthew Wilcox | 2017-01-25 | 1 | -1/+1 |